C14H14N2O2 — CID 61223962
N-[4-(2-hydroxyethyl)phenyl]pyridine-2-carboxamide (PubChem CID 61223962) has the molecular formula C14H14N2O2 and a molecular weight of 242.28 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-[4-(2-hydroxyethyl)phenyl]pyridine-2-carboxamide.
